My first finish is my Stripey Goodness fingerless mitts.  I started these in 2015!!!!  So no pattern, I just k2p2 around....The yarn was a kit from Quaere Fibre and The Purple Purl.  The color is called Modern Christmas.  There is actually enough left for me to make a pair of socks too....I had to fix the Ravelry page, as the wrong yarn was listed.  


I just started this this past week......well I actually cast on awhile ago...I pulled it out of the bag and there were some cast-on stitches....The hat is Put a Pom On It by Nancy Ricci...it's a free pattern...The yarn is Dragonfly Fibers Super Traveller in Stone Circle.  I actually have two other skeins, that I'll be making a cowl with, they are the grey and the copper color in this colorway.
